'24 Draftees who could be on the fast track to the bigs
The 2023 Draft class wasted no time getting players to the Majors. Nolan Schanuel joined the Angels last August, just 37 days after turning pro. Wyatt Langford became the third-fastest drafted position player to make an Opening Day roster, claiming a starting role with the defending World Series champion Rangers.

Guardians make Aussie star Bazzana No. 1 overall pick
If you’re trying to describe the type of hitter the Guardians prefer to have in their organization, you’ll probably think of a gritty, versatile player with elite contact ability, off-the-charts plate discipline and some potential for power. That’s why Travis Bazzana and Cleveland are a match made in heaven.
